Around 70% of law firms have been affected by cyber-attacks, which highlights the need for secure data management solutions. A vdr for legal services is a repository online that allows legal teams to upload and organize confidential information. They can share secure information with partners, customers and other parties without having to worry about data leaks or security breaches. Information stored in a VDR can differ based on the legal context or transaction. It could contain contracts, financial records and intellectual property documents.

When it comes to complex transactions such as mergers and acquisitions, legal teams employ vdr for legal services to store and share sensitive information with multiple parties within a single platform. With granular folders and file-level permissions, legal teams can ensure that only authorized users are able to view specific information while keeping others out. The vdr allows legal teams to conduct due diligence more efficiently by giving real-time insights.

Another benefit of using a VDR for legal services is that it enables lawyers and other stakeholders to easily review documents on their own time and place regardless of where they are. This can reduce travel expenses, improve collaboration, and improve productivity. A vdr is also able to allow lawyers to electronically sign documents which reduces paperwork and speeding the process.

When selecting a vdr to provide legal services, it’s important to select a system with a solid security system and an intuitive user interface. A vdr that is difficult to navigate will discourage lawyers from using it, and can cause frustration for clients as well as other stakeholders. However a vdr that’s simple to use will allow legal professionals to find the documents they require which can boost client satisfaction and improve the image of the firm.
